亚洲免费在线-亚洲免费在线播放-亚洲免费在线观看-亚洲免费在线观看视频-亚洲免费在线看-亚洲免费在线视频

python實(shí)現(xiàn)圖片處理和特征提取詳解

系統(tǒng) 2237 0

python實(shí)現(xiàn)圖片處理和特征提取詳解_第1張圖片

這是一張靈異事件圖。。。開(kāi)個(gè)玩笑,這就是一張普通的圖片。

毫無(wú)疑問(wèn),上面的那副圖畫(huà)看起來(lái)像一幅電腦背景圖片。這些都?xì)w功于我的妹妹,她能夠?qū)⒁恍┛瓷先テ婀值臇|西變得十分吸引眼球。然而,我們生活在數(shù)字圖片的年代,我們也很少去想這些圖片是在怎么存儲(chǔ)在存儲(chǔ)器上的或者去想這些圖片是如何通過(guò)各種變化生成的。

在這篇文章中,我將帶著你了解一些基本的圖片特征處理。data massaging 依然是一樣的:特征提取,但是這里我們還需要對(duì)跟多的密集數(shù)據(jù)進(jìn)行處理,但同時(shí)數(shù)據(jù)清理是在數(shù)據(jù)庫(kù)、表、文本等中進(jìn)行。這是如何對(duì)圖片進(jìn)行處理的呢?我們將看到圖片是怎么存儲(chǔ)在硬盤(pán)中的,同時(shí)我們可以通過(guò)使用基本的操作來(lái)處理圖片。
導(dǎo)入圖片

在python中導(dǎo)入圖片是非常容易的。下面的代碼就是python如何導(dǎo)入代碼的:

python實(shí)現(xiàn)圖片處理和特征提取詳解_第2張圖片

代碼解釋?zhuān)?

這幅圖片有一些顏色和許多像素組成,為了形象這幅圖片是如何存儲(chǔ)的,把每一個(gè)像素想象成矩陣中的每一個(gè)元素。現(xiàn)在這些元素包含三個(gè)不同的密度信息,分別為顏色紅、綠、藍(lán)(RGB)。所以一個(gè)RGB的圖片就變成了三維的矩陣。每一個(gè)數(shù)字就是顏色的密度(RGB)

讓我們來(lái)看看一些轉(zhuǎn)化:

python實(shí)現(xiàn)圖片處理和特征提取詳解_第3張圖片

就像你在上面看到的一樣,我們對(duì)三個(gè)顏色維度進(jìn)行了一些操作轉(zhuǎn)變。黃色不是一種直接表示的顏色,它是紅色和綠色的組合色。我們通過(guò)設(shè)置其他顏色密度值為零而得到了這些變化。

將圖像轉(zhuǎn)換為二維矩陣

處理圖像的三維色有時(shí)可能是很復(fù)雜和冗余的。如果我們壓縮圖像為二維矩陣,在特征提取后,它將變得更簡(jiǎn)單。這是通過(guò)灰度圖像或二值化(Binarizing)圖像。當(dāng)圖片顯示為不同灰色強(qiáng)度組合時(shí)灰度圖像比二值化(Binarizing)圖像顏色更加飽滿(mǎn),而二值化(binarzing)只是簡(jiǎn)單的構(gòu)建一個(gè)充滿(mǎn)0和1的二維矩陣而已。

這里將叫你如何將RGB圖片轉(zhuǎn)變成灰度圖像:

python實(shí)現(xiàn)圖片處理和特征提取詳解_第4張圖片

就如你所見(jiàn),圖片的維度已經(jīng)降為了兩種灰度值了,然而圖片的特征在兩幅圖片中依然清晰可見(jiàn)。這就是為什么灰色圖像在硬盤(pán)上存貯更加節(jié)約空間。

現(xiàn)在讓我們來(lái)二值化灰色圖像,這是通過(guò)找到閥值和灰色度像素標(biāo)志(flagging the pixels of Grayscale)。在這篇文章中我已經(jīng)通過(guò)Otsu‘s方法來(lái)找到閥值的,Otsu‘s方法是通過(guò)最大化兩類(lèi)不同像素點(diǎn)之間的距離來(lái)計(jì)算最優(yōu)閥值的,也就是說(shuō)這個(gè)閥值最小化了同類(lèi)間的變量值。

python實(shí)現(xiàn)圖片處理和特征提取詳解_第5張圖片

模糊化圖片

本文最后部分我們將介紹更多有關(guān)特征提取的內(nèi)容:圖像模糊。灰度或二值圖像有時(shí)需要捕獲更多的圖像而模糊圖像在這樣的場(chǎng)景下是非常方便的。例如,在這張圖片如果鐵路軌道比鞋子更加重要,模糊處理將會(huì)添加跟多的值。從這個(gè)例子中我們對(duì)模糊處理變得更清晰。模糊算法需要將鄰近像素的加權(quán)平均值加到周?chē)總€(gè)顏色像素中。下面是一個(gè)模糊處理的例子:

python實(shí)現(xiàn)圖片處理和特征提取詳解_第6張圖片

對(duì)上面的照片模糊處理后,我們清楚地看到鞋已經(jīng)與鐵路軌道具有相同的密度等級(jí)。因此,在許多場(chǎng)景中這種技術(shù)非常方便。
讓我們看一個(gè)實(shí)際例子。我們想在一個(gè)小鎮(zhèn)的照片上統(tǒng)計(jì)的人數(shù)。但是照片上還有一些建筑圖像。現(xiàn)在建筑背后的人的顏色強(qiáng)度會(huì)低于建筑本身。因此,這些人我們就難以計(jì)數(shù)。模糊處理場(chǎng)景后才能平衡建筑和人在圖像中的顏色強(qiáng)度。

完整的代碼:

            
image = imread(r"C:\Users\Tavish\Desktop\7.jpg")
show_img(image)

red, yellow = image.copy(), image.copy()
red[:,:,(1,2)] = 0
yellow[:,:,2]=0
show_images(images=[red,yellow], titles=['Red Intensity','Yellow Intensity'])

from skimage.color import rgb2gray
gray_image = rgb2gray(image)
show_images(images=[image,gray_image],titles=["Color","Grayscale"])
print "Colored image shape:", image.shape
print "Grayscale image shape:", gray_image.shape

from skimage.filter import threshold_otsu
thresh = threshold_otsu(gray_image)
binary = gray_image > thresh
show_images(images=[gray_image,binary_image,binary],titles=["Grayscale","Otsu Binary"])

from skimage.filter import gaussian_filter
blurred_image = gaussian_filter(gray_image,sigma=20)
show_images(images=[gray_image,blurred_image],titles=["Gray Image","20 Sigma Blur"])

          

總結(jié)

以上就是本文關(guān)于python實(shí)現(xiàn)圖片處理和特征提取詳解的全部?jī)?nèi)容,希望對(duì)大家有所幫助。感興趣的朋友可以繼續(xù)參閱本站:

python圖像常規(guī)操作

在Python web中實(shí)現(xiàn)驗(yàn)證碼圖片代碼分享

Python生成數(shù)字圖片代碼分享

如有不足之處,歡迎留言指出。感謝朋友們對(duì)本站的支持!


更多文章、技術(shù)交流、商務(wù)合作、聯(lián)系博主

微信掃碼或搜索:z360901061

微信掃一掃加我為好友

QQ號(hào)聯(lián)系: 360901061

您的支持是博主寫(xiě)作最大的動(dòng)力,如果您喜歡我的文章,感覺(jué)我的文章對(duì)您有幫助,請(qǐng)用微信掃描下面二維碼支持博主2元、5元、10元、20元等您想捐的金額吧,狠狠點(diǎn)擊下面給點(diǎn)支持吧,站長(zhǎng)非常感激您!手機(jī)微信長(zhǎng)按不能支付解決辦法:請(qǐng)將微信支付二維碼保存到相冊(cè),切換到微信,然后點(diǎn)擊微信右上角掃一掃功能,選擇支付二維碼完成支付。

【本文對(duì)您有幫助就好】

您的支持是博主寫(xiě)作最大的動(dòng)力,如果您喜歡我的文章,感覺(jué)我的文章對(duì)您有幫助,請(qǐng)用微信掃描上面二維碼支持博主2元、5元、10元、自定義金額等您想捐的金額吧,站長(zhǎng)會(huì)非常 感謝您的哦!!!

發(fā)表我的評(píng)論
最新評(píng)論 總共0條評(píng)論
主站蜘蛛池模板: 亚洲精品久久久久久久777 | 亚洲免费成人网 | 国产精品成人免费观看 | 欧美日韩在大午夜爽爽影院 | 久久福利 | 四虎国产精品永久在线看 | 欧美性生活一级 | 精品国产区一区二区三区在线观看 | 图片专区亚洲欧美另类 | 亚洲成人小视频 | 亚洲激情在线观看 | 性欧美成人依依影院 | 色女孩综合 | 亚洲国产美女精品久久 | 国产精品久久久尹人香蕉 | 思思影院 | 亚洲国产成人久久精品图片 | 亚洲一区三区 | 人成午夜视频 | 国产一级黄色网 | 欧美在线国产 | 亚洲精品国产福利片 | 男女一级做片a性视频 | 老司机午夜永久在线观看 | 久草网在线观看 | 日韩在线视频网站 | 免费a大片 | 久久国产高清字幕中文 | 99久久免费国产精品特黄 | 亚洲成年人免费网站 | 久草婷婷在线 | 色综合久久中文色婷婷 | sese视频在线 | xxx中国毛茸茸 | 韩国一大片a毛片 | 免费看欧美一级特黄α大片 | 亚洲毛片一级带毛片基地 | 成人性色生活片免费看爆迷你毛片 | 狠狠操亚洲 | 国产在线精品香蕉综合网一区 | 九九365资源稳定资源站 |